Common use of Outcome Measurements Clause in Contracts

Outcome Measurements. General Management Solutions, Inc. will maintain systems in place to measure program performance and ensure continuous quality improvement. To measure progress toward career center success indicators GMSI will use the number of dislocated workers identified as in need of short-term occupational skills training, # enrolled in Bootcamp/ short-term occupational skills training/ Work Experience, retention rate of short term occupational skills training/ Work Experience, exited with employment, and the average wage first quarter after exit with employment. The Program Manager will utilize XXXXXXX.XXX to schedule services and track the participants’ progress. A monthly report compiled by the Program Manager due to OEWD by the 13th of each month will include the following: o Number identified as in need of short-term occupational skills training/Work Experience. o Number enrolled in Bootcamp o Number enrolled in short-term occupational skills training outside of Bootcamp by training type. o Number of North Carolina Institute of Minority Economic Development (NCIMED) Pilot program students provided Work Experience o Number of Dislocated Worker Contingency Fund (DWCF) recipients completing training by month and total. o Number of NCIMED Pilot Program Participants completing the three month Work Experience o Number DWCF recipients exiting program with employment o Average wage first, second, and third quarter after exit
